#!/usr/bin/env bash
# Failover drill against the running docker cluster (bash docker/deploy.sh first).
# Kills the ACTIVE central node (docker kill = SIGKILL, the hard-crash path that
# review 01 found had NO automatic recovery before the SBR downing provider was
# enabled) and measures how long Traefik takes to route to the survivor.
set -euo pipefail
TRAEFIK_URL="${TRAEFIK_URL:-http://localhost:9000}"
TIMEOUT_S="${TIMEOUT_S:-90}"
active_container() {
if curl -sf -o /dev/null "http://localhost:9001/health/active"; then echo scadabridge-central-a
elif curl -sf -o /dev/null "http://localhost:9002/health/active"; then echo scadabridge-central-b
else echo "ERROR: no active central node found" >&2; exit 1; fi
}
VICTIM=$(active_container)
echo "Active central node: ${VICTIM} — killing it (SIGKILL, crash path)"
docker kill "${VICTIM}" > /dev/null
START=$(date +%s)
echo "Waiting for the survivor to become active through Traefik (${TRAEFIK_URL}/health/active)..."
while true; do
ELAPSED=$(( $(date +%s) - START ))
if curl -sf -o /dev/null "${TRAEFIK_URL}/health/active"; then
echo "PASS: failover complete in ${ELAPSED}s (design budget ~25s + Traefik health interval)"
break
fi
if (( ELAPSED > TIMEOUT_S )); then
echo "FAIL: no active central node after ${ELAPSED}s — SBR/singleton handover did not recover" >&2
docker start "${VICTIM}" > /dev/null
exit 1
fi
sleep 1
done
SURVIVOR=$([ "${VICTIM}" = scadabridge-central-a ] && echo scadabridge-central-b || echo scadabridge-central-a)
echo "Survivor singleton evidence (last 20 matching log lines from ${SURVIVOR}):"
docker logs "${SURVIVOR}" 2>&1 | grep -Ei "singleton|oldest|Downing|Removed" | tail -20 || true
echo "Restarting ${VICTIM} and waiting for it to rejoin..."
docker start "${VICTIM}" > /dev/null
sleep 5
echo "Drill complete. Verify on the Health dashboard that both nodes show Up and the survivor is Primary."
